English Speaking Union meet: Pakistanis moving in the right direction: Ambassador Sanchez

June 10, 2015 at 12:53 am | News Desk

 

A meeting of the English Speaking Union (ESU) was held at the residence of its member, Khalid Malik and nearly all members attended the event. The Secretary General of the Union MuzaffarQuereshi moderated the proceedings. The Spanish Ambassador to Pakistan, His Excellency Javier Carbajosa Sanchez was the chief guest.

Welcoming the gathering, ESU President Retired Major General Masud Akram began by thanking Mr Malik for his generous offer to host the occasion. He then spoke of his aims to make the ESU a more vibrant and well known organization. He said that the Union promotes mutual advancement of education of the English-speaking peoples of the world, respecting their heritage, traditions and aspirations, the events and issues of the day affecting them and their inter-relationships. ESU 1

He said that the use of English as a shared language is a means of international communication of knowledge and understanding, provided that these are at all times pursued in a non-political and non-sectarian manner. He invited Ambassador Sanchez to give his key note address.

Sharing his experiences of serving in Pakistan, Mr. Sanchez said that Pakistanis are the most resilient people in the world. They have faced tragedies of the 2005 earthquake, the floods in 2010- 11, the massacre at The Army Public School, Wagah border and hundreds of other incidents of terrorism. Mr. Sanchez noted that all these events did not affect the nation’s morale to fight the threat of terrorism. He said that the world acknowledged Pakistan’s efforts against terrorism and appreciates the successes of the Zarb-i-Azb military operation.

Mr. Sanchez opined that Pakistan has started moving in the right direction as democracy is gaining strength. He added signs are visible that the people of Pakistan, irrespective of their linguistic differences, are rising as a united nation against the menace of terrorism, crime and corruption. These are great times, Sanchez said, as nationhood is the fundamental factor for nations to achieve growth and prosperity. ESU 2

The Spanish Ambassador said that Pakistan has huge potential for growth. Its ideally located geography, vast agricultural lands and above all, a very willing work force, all contribute as necessary ingredients to sustain high growth rates.

There followed a question-answer session and the putting forth of suggestions related to membership, activities and other points of general interest which would make the ESU a more vibrant organization. This was followed by the re-election of the incumbent President, Vice President and other office-bearers.

Business over, dinner was served and the gracious hostess also joined the gathering, making sure everyone was looked after, which we were, while enjoying the delicious specialties that were served.

The English-Speaking Union (ESU) is an international educational charity which was founded by the journalist Sir Evelyn Wrench in 1918. It aims to bring together and empower people of different languages and cultures, by building skills and confidence in communication, such that individuals realise their potential.
